Great mic for the price.To turn off the RGB, long press the capacitive zone.Easy to set up, plug and play. Sounds has good clarity and works well in my untreated room. While the mic is a bit bulkier than some other ones, it is a good size for me. Comes with a metal stand and fork, so as long as you don't drop it or transport it insecurely it should be fairly durable during normal use.After looking at several online reviews for the microphone, it looks like Fifine has actually modified the microphone by shifting the capsule back from the grate. This should make its plosive performance even better. I was still able to get decent proximity effect as well.

For like half the cost of the Blue Yeti, this is about the same quality sound (this is a good thing). I know people tend to dislike plastic mics because they think they feel cheap, but tbh I actually quite like the plastic they used, it feels nice. Visually, the mic is great, love how simple but effective the LEDs are, and the build quality is really nice. USB port works great, the biggest problem I had with the Blue Yeti was the usb port being very loose, this one has a very solid one. Only thing that brings my review down from 5 stars is that for some reason the direct mic monitoring through the microphone port on the mic itself is controlled by the output volume for system sound on the computer it's connected to, so you either have to deafen yourself with the extremely loud system sound through the mic (it feels like I have to turn it to 1% to be able to even hear myself think) or turn it way down (that wasn't sarcasm, when I'm playing games I usually literally have to turn the system volume to 1%, and then turn the game volume itself down) and be basically unable to hear your voice with the mic monitoring. Super good mic at this price point though.

I purchased the bundle with this microphone and the heavy-duty boom arm as an upgrade from the mic on my gaming headset for streaming on Twitch, and the sound quality is undeniably a lot better. I actually read a couple of articles and spent two days perusing different options before settling on this one. Limited space was one of the biggest factors, alongside sound quality / polar pattern, since I have a lot of BG noise. This item also has more genuine positive reviews (according to Review Checker) than a LOT of more expensive items.Despite being made of plastic, the microphone feels very solid; the plastic itself is thick & has good weight to it, with a satin finish. The RGB lights are a bit bright for my low-key stream, so I keep them off; but if you have a neon / RGB aesthetic it'll fit right in.It's pretty much Plug & Play with the USB connector, and of course having the option to upgrade is really nice. Using Windows & OBS, setup required no extra clicks beyond adding the mic as a source and adjusting filters. Tap-to-mute function is receptive, so you don't have to mash it. Most importantly, my voice is much clearer and more crisp, and you can't even hear all the fans running in the background (which was a HUGE issue before)!The boom arm can honestly be a little intimidating at first. Just be careful which way you try to bend it, and hold it by the joints while adjusting. But it rests right into a simple vice clamp mount, which is padded so it won't wreck your tabletop. After a few tries, setting it up literally takes 90 seconds. It would've been nice to receive something to store the boom arm in; for now I've been using the box it shipped in...I also recommend setting up the clamp mount first, adjusting the boom as closely as possible to the desired position, and then setting the arm into the clamp mount to reduce strain on the moving parts & extend their lifetime.Overall, I'm pleased I chose this option. Setup is quick and simple. It works well in the limited space that I have by fitting onto the edge of my table and honestly, after sitting with it for a few minutes, I completely forget it's there. (Thankfully I got the heavy-duty boom cause I KNEW I'd bump into it lol)If you're a streamer, content creator, podcaster, etc looking for a decent starter mic that'll sound & look good without breaking bank, and especially if you have limited space, give this one a shot. I'll probably be sticking with it for a long while.
